Johanna,

The scripts linked on the NSEdoc pages are always the very latest from our
development trunk. We recently pushed a change to update to the Lua 5.3
language from Lua 5.2. This means that some scripts which use new language
features or syntax will not be backwards-compatible with older Nmap
releases. Your best bet is to update to the latest stable version, 7.12,
which contains a copy of the script that will work with that version.

Hello All

http-vuln-cve2014-3704 is released with version 7. as announced here
http://seclists.org/nmap-announce/2016/1

I'm using an older version of nmap in mac and linux (6.47)

After downloading the file, when I try running the script I get an error
:164: 'unexpected symbol near '<'

Using the newest version the scripts works without issues.

Can the script work using older versions or does it work only for the new
version?
